VBsupport перешел с домена .ORG на родной .RU
Ура!
Пожалуйста, обновите свои закладки - VBsupport.ru
Блок РКН снят, форум доступен на всей территории России, включая новые терртории, без VPN
На форуме введена премодерация ВСЕХ новых пользователей
Почта с временных сервисов, типа mailinator.com, gawab.com и/или прочих, которые предоставляют временный почтовый ящик без регистрации и/или почтовый ящик для рассылки спама, отслеживается и блокируется, а так же заносится в спам-блок форума, аккаунты удаляются
Если вы хотите приобрести какой то скрипт/продукт/хак из каталогов перечисленных ниже: Каталог модулей/хаков
Ещё раз обращаем Ваше внимание: всё, что Вы скачиваете и устанавливаете на свой форум, Вы устанавливаете исключительно на свой страх и риск.
Сообщество vBSupport'а физически не в состоянии проверять все стили, хаки и нули, выкладываемые пользователями.
Помните: безопасность Вашего проекта - Ваша забота. Убедительная просьба: при обнаружении уязвимостей или сомнительных кодов обязательно отписывайтесь в теме хака/стиля
Спасибо за понимание
Установлена vBulletin CMS 4.2.1.
Проблема в том что главная страница CMS (http://www.airforce.ru/content/) грузится очень долго (~30 секунд), в то время как главная страница форума (http://forums.airforce.ru/) и статьи открываются за 2-3 секунды.
Установлен vBSEO (вместе с sitemap генератором), но при отключенном плагине картина не меняется.
Что может вызывать такую задержку? В каком направлении копать?
В корне CMS находится также htaccess в котором определено довольно много редиректов статей REDIRECT 301 со старого сайта на новый.
Думается, дело не в размере файлов. Как я написал, долго открывается только главная страница, с остальными проблем нет.
Можно, конечно, попробовать сжимать файлы... может поможет. Отпишу попозже каков будет результат.
kerk
k0t
Join Date: May 2005
Location: localhost
Posts: 28,748
Версия vB: 3.8.x
Пол:
Reputation:
Гуру 20279
Репутация в разделе: 8443
1
"главная" страница в 4, генерит больше сотни запросов в дефолте
а если на нее натыкана куча "виджетов", которые так же делают какие то запросы, то возможно отсюда и тормоза
включить дебаг режим и смотреть кол-во запросов/потребляемой памяти и прочее...
20.68sec - открываем домен
еще 23.98sec - добираемся др первой страницы
вывод:
удалить все что есть в .htaccess
удалить vbseo
@DmitriS
Продвинутый
Join Date: Feb 2007
Location: Нидерланды
Posts: 62
Версия vB: 4.2.х
Пол:
Reputation:
Опытный 15
Репутация в разделе: 14
0
Спасибо всем за участие и советы!
Похоже, что я разобрался в чем дело.
На главной странице у меня расположены превьюшки новых статей, размещенных на сайте. Так вот, похоже что эти превьюшки генерируются динамически при каждой загрузке страницы. И время генерации прямо пропорционально объему статьи. Пару дней назад я добавил большую многостраничную статью, и после того как ее превьюшка появилась на главной, началась эта проблема с загрузкой.
После удаления именно этой одной превьюшки время загрузки вернулось в норму.
Возникает вопрос, неужели нельзя сгенерировать страницу один раз и потом грузить ее из кэша? Почему она генерируется каждый раз заново? И еще совершенно непонятно, почему время генерации зависит от объема статьи? Похоже что статья целиком (со всеми ее страницами) сначала грузится в память и потом только первые несколько строк выдергиваются в превью... Странное решение.
статья в 60к знаков, с кучей картинок, не влияет на загрузку
(во всяком случае у меня)
У вас проблема лежит еще за долго допоявления любого контента
протестируйте, просмотрите и поймете
tools.pingdom.com
@DmitriS
Продвинутый
Join Date: Feb 2007
Location: Нидерланды
Posts: 62
Версия vB: 4.2.х
Пол:
Reputation:
Опытный 15
Репутация в разделе: 14
0
60К наверное не влияет. Но у меня проблема появилась после публикации многостраничной статьи общим размером всех страниц в пару мегабайт. (Много страничная статья - я имею в виду
Спасибо за ссылку на интересный тул! Протестировал загрузку С превьюшкой большой статьи и БЕЗ превьюшки одной только большой статьи.
Результат: БЕЗ время загрузки 6,35 сек, С время загрузки 48,22 сек. Интересно, что вся разница появляется именно в самом начале загрузки. Т.е. превьюшки генерятся именно в этот момент.
Привьюшка давным давно сгенерирована, и лежит она в аттачментах, весит 3-5kb, что ну никак не может повлиять на загрузку
Еще раз говорю, и утверждаю:
у вас 2 проблемы - .htaccess и vbseo
То что Вы пытаетесь себя успокоить, мол нашел решение: трумбс не показывается, наверно генерируется
Это иллюзия самоуспокоения
есть привью нет его у вас потерянных 5 секунд на раздумывание как загрузить 650к контента